-
输入一个正数x和一个正整数n,求下列算式的值。要求定义两个调用函数:fact(n)计算n的阶乘;mypow(x,n)计算x的n次幂(即xn),两个函数的返回值类型是double。x - x2/2! + x3/3! + ... + (-1)n-1xn/n!×输出保留4位小数。输入x n输出数列和样例输入4 3样例输出6.6667
-
关于以下代码的描述中,正确的是( )。 { def fact(n): if n == 0: return 1 else: return n * fact(n - 1) num = eval(input("请输入一个数:")) print(fact(abs(num))) } 选项: A、接受用户输入的整数 n,判断n是否是素数并输出结论 B、接受用户输入的整数 n,判断n 是否是完数并输出结论 C、接受用户输入的整数 n,输出从0到n的乘积 D、接受用户输入的整数 n,输出n的绝对值的阶乘
-
下列有关阶乘函数的表述错误的是?( )选项: A:log(n!)=Θ(nlogn) B:n!=о(nn) C:n!=ω ( 2n) D:log(n!)=Ο(n2)
-
求自然数n的阶乘n!,其中n由用户通过键盘输入
-
从键盘输入一个正整数,保存到n中,计算 :(1)0+1+...+n的值(2)n阶乘的值
-
随机输入一个正整数n,求n的阶乘。
-
关于以下代码的描述中,错误的是________。 def fact(n): s=1 for i in range(1,n+1): s*=i return s 选项: A、ange()函数是Python内置函数 B、fact(n)函数功能为求n的阶乘 C、代码中n是可选参数 D、函数返回值的类型是整型
-
下面代码实现的功能描述正确的是( ) def fact(n): if n==0: return 0 else: return n*fact(n-1) Num = eval(input(”请输入一个整数”)) print(fact(abs(int(Num)))) 选项: A、接受用户输入的整数 n, 判断 n 是否是完数并输出结论 B、接受用户输入的整数 n,判断 n 是否为素数并输出结论 C、接受用户输入的整数 n, 判断 n 是否是水仙花数 D、接受用户输入的整数 n, 输出 n 的阶乘值
-
下面代码实现的功能描述的是n=int(input())if n%2==0:print(1)else:print(0) 选项: A、接受用户输入的整数n,判断n是否是素数并输出结论 B、接受用户输入的整数n,判断n是否是偶数并输出结论 C、接受用户输入的整数n,判断n是否是水仙花数 D、接受用户输入的整数n,输出n的阶乘值
-
下面代码实现的功能描述为def fact(n): if n==0: return 1 else: return n*fact(n-1)num =eval(input("请输入一个整数:"))print(fact(abs(int(num))))选项: A:接受用户输入的整数N,判断N是否是素数并输出结论; B:接受用户输入的整数N,判断N是否是水仙花数; C:接受用户输入的整数N,判断N是否是完数并输出结论; D:接受用户输入的整数N,输出N的阶乘值